About White Collar Crime Lawyers / Attorney
White collar defence work focuses on allegations where money, documents, digital records, or professional duties are central. A White Collar Crime Lawyers / Attorney typically:
- Assesses exposure under IPC/BNS (as applicable), CrPC/BNSS (as applicable), and special laws (depending on the case)
- Handles pre-FIR and post-FIR strategy, including replies to notices and representation during investigation
- Advises on arrest risk, anticipatory/regular bail, and conditions compliance
- Builds documentary defence (ledgers, emails, contracts, audit trails, bank records)
- Coordinates with forensic/cyber experts when needed
- Represents clients in trial, discharge, quashing/482 petitions (where applicable), appeals, and settlement/compounding routes (where legally permissible)
When someone in Itarsi typically needs one
You may need a White Collar Crime Lawyers / Attorney if you receive:
- A police call, notice, or summons connected to a financial complaint
- A bank or employer complaint alleging fraud, misappropriation, or data misuse
- A cyber complaint involving UPI/OTP, SIM swap, phishing, or account takeover allegations
- A demand for documents, device access, or appearance during investigation
- A court summons or charge-sheet filing

Licensing/certification required in India
In India, a lawyer/advocate handling criminal defence should be:
- Enrolled with a State Bar Council and eligible to practice under the Advocates Act, 1961
- Competent to appear before the relevant courts (Magistrate/Sessions/High Court as applicable)
- For Supreme Court practice, an Advocate-on-Record qualification is required (usually not relevant for Itarsi-level matters)

Cost of Hiring a White Collar Crime Lawyers / Attorney in Itarsi
For Itarsi, a practical expectation is that fees will be stage-based: consultation + immediate relief (bail/stay) + investigation appearances + trial/arguments + appeal (if any). For financial-crime allegations, documentation work can become a significant portion of effort.
Average price range (₹)
Indicative ranges often seen in similar Indian town markets (Varies / depends):
- Consultation: ₹1,000–₹3,000
- Notice reply / representation during inquiry: ₹5,000–₹25,000
- Anticipatory/regular bail: ₹15,000–₹75,000
- Trial (full case): ₹60,000–₹3,00,000+
- Appeal / revision / High Court coordination (if required): ₹50,000–₹5,00,000+
Emergency pricing (if applicable)
Emergency work (late-night arrest risk, weekend filings, urgent bail) can be priced higher because it compresses drafting and coordination into limited time. Some lawyers charge:
- A higher one-time “urgent appearance” fee, or
- A premium on the bail package
Not publicly stated for Itarsi as a market-wide standard; it varies by lawyer.
What affects cost
- Stage of the case: pre-FIR advice vs post-FIR vs post-charge-sheet trial
- Court level: Magistrate/Sessions vs High Court coordination (often outside town)
- Volume of documents: ledgers, bank statements, call records, email trails, invoices
- Number of accused/complainants: multi-party matters need more coordination
- Alleged sections/special laws: economic offences, cyber allegations, or special statutes increase complexity
- Urgency and travel: short deadlines, custody timelines, or outstation hearings

What documents should I carry for a white collar case consultation?
Carry the complaint/FIR copy (if available), any notices, contracts/invoices, payment proofs, bank statements (relevant months), chat/email threads, and a simple timeline. If devices were seized, bring the seizure memo/panchnama details if available.

Can a white collar case be settled or withdrawn?
Some matters can be settled/compounded depending on sections and court permission; others cannot. Even when settlement is possible, it must be documented properly and approved through the correct legal process.
How long do white collar cases take in Itarsi courts?
Varies / depends. Timelines depend on investigation length, charge-sheet filing, witness schedules, and court backlog. Bail/urgent relief is faster; full trials can take significantly longer.
What red flags should I avoid when hiring?
Be cautious if someone guarantees results, refuses to give a written fee scope, or asks you to sign blank papers. Also avoid counsel who won’t share a clear plan for notices, investigation appearances, and document strategy.
